SC-6536Z automatic distillation measuring instrument

更新時間:2023-03-24      點擊次數:1170

Instrument Overview

This instrument is the third generation product newly developed by our company. It is designed and manufactured according to the standard test method of the national standard GB/T6536-2010 "Petroleum Products - Determination of Atmospheric Distillation Characteristics", and can measure two samples simultaneously. It can meet the national standard GB/T3146-2010 "Determination of Distillation Range of Industrial Aromatic Hydrocarbons and Related Materials - Part 1: Distillation Method" and international standards such as ASTM D86/ASTM D850/ASTM D1078-IP195/ISO 3405. It integrates mechanical, optical, and electronic technology, using imported sensors, and the level reading of the graduated cylinder adopts an imported CNC optical tracking and detection system. Automatically complete the entire distillation process experiment, widely applicable to the measurement and analysis of distillation characteristics of distillate fuels such as natural gasoline (stable light hydrocarbons), light and intermediate fractions, automotive spark ignition engine fuels, aviation gasoline, jet fuel, diesel and kerosene, as well as naphtha and naphtha solvent oil products under normal pressure.

Technical Parameters

1. Working power supply: AC220V ± 10% 50Hz 2.6KW
2. Operation mode: Windows operating system 10.4 inch color LCD touch screen
3. Test samples: 2 (two identical or different samples can be tested simultaneously)
4. Temperature range: 0~450 ℃, resolution 0.1 ℃, imported from Germany PT100 temperature sensor
5. Refrigeration method: German imported compressor refrigeration
6. Distillation rate: 2-10 mL/min (freely set, automatically adjusted)
7. Volume detection range: 0-100mL, resolution 0.1mL
8. Cold bath temperature range: 0~80 ℃, temperature control accuracy: 0.2 ℃
9. Cold trap temperature range: 0~60 ℃, temperature control accuracy: 0.2 ℃
10. Air pressure measurement range: 300~1100hpa, accuracy ± 3hpa, built-in pressure sensor, automatic value correction
11. Safety protection system: built-in ultraviolet flame sensor automatically monitors, and automatically opens the protective gas valve when a flame occurs
12. Protective gas interface: φ 7.5~8mm; The protective gas is nitrogen or carbon dioxide, and the pressure is not less than 0.6Mpa
13. Overall dimensions of the instrument: 720X500X660cm (length/width/height), net weight: about 90kg
14. Operating ambient temperature: 5~40 ℃ Operating relative humidity: ≤ 80%

Performance characteristics

1. The temperature of the cold bath and the cold trap are controlled by a segmented program. The cold bath part adopts a metal bath technology that integrates condensing tubes and refrigeration evaporation tubes, ensuring direct conduction of cold and heat without liquid heat transfer media, which is both safe and convenient
2. The instrument adopts a lifting and self-locking lifting control technology, which allows the heating furnace to quickly lift and fall back, allowing it to stay at any position, truly realizing the technology of non polarity adjustment
3. The heating furnace adopts a ceramic heating device pulse modulated infrared radiation heating method, with fast heating and cooling speed, ensuring safety and reliability
4. Compressors, heating ceramic components, temperature sensors, and refrigeration diverter valves are all imported components, ensuring the accuracy and reliability of instrument data, while maintaining a long service life and low failure rate
5. The test data can be stored without restriction and viewed at any time. The built-in micro thermal printer outputs the test results, and can also be exported through a USB flash drive to print data reports on the computer;
6. Two samples can be measured at the same time. After the experiment, the furnace frame automatically slides down, cutting off heat and waste heat. The electric furnace cooling fan can automatically start rapid cooling and improve testing efficiency
7. Infrared modulation optical technology realizes liquid level tracking detection and initial distillation detection, without environmental interference, automatically detecting the position of volume zero point and accurately determining the dry point.
8. Coated quartz orifice plate, heat insulation without cracking, unique orifice plate installation structure, replacement of orifice plates with different apertures without adjustment
9. Optional laboratory intelligent control module system can be equipped to achieve remote intelligent information management of the Internet of Things. The cloud platform can monitor the operation status of this instrument in real time, including user information, usage time, test duration, usage frequency, different usage scenarios, and other data.
